As a first assignment 64P you're looking at being a buyer in an operational contracting shop, being taught the trade by a civilian or SrA. Typical hours look like 0730-1630, with it hitting 10-12 hours during the end of the fiscal year because the pots of money operational cons can draw from only exist in a single fiscal year for the most part, so you gotta spend anything left. Your job entails taking requirements from customers on base (IE, CE needs a contractor to come fix a roof), doing market research to find said contractor, and finally getting the papers ready to make the work happen.
